(a) If the board, after receiving and reviewing a completed, signed and dated renewal application form, requires further information or documents to determine the applicant's qualification for renewal of licensure, the board shall:
- (1) So notify the applicant in writing within 30 days; and
- (2) Specify the additional information or documents it requires.
- (b) The board shall deny the renewal application if the applicant does not submit the additional information or documents requested within 30 days of its request.
- (c) The board shall approve or deny the renewal application within 120 days of the date that the board’s office has received the completed, signed and dated application form and any additional information or documents requested.
- (d) If the board denies the renewal application, the board shall provide the renewal applicant with written reasons for the denial.
(e) A renewal applicant wishing to challenge the board's denial shall:
- (1) Make a written request for a hearing of the challenge; and
(2) Make it:
- a. Within 60 days of the notice of the denial; or
- b. If the applicant is on active military duty outside the United States, within 60 days of his or her return to the United States or release from duty, whichever occurs later.
